The session includes songs and talks on subaltern music and its connection to community resilience. Next we talk to New York-based writer, educator, human rights, media and cultural activist, Dr Partha Banerjee on mental wellness in pandemic times. Mental wellness in trying times such as this especially in the poor, underprivileged, disempowered and immigrant communities is grossly overlooked, under-examined, and media-ignored. COVID-19 pandemic has not only destroyed the impoverished and vulnerable physically. It has greatly impacted them on an emotional and psychological front. We must explore the extent of the damage, and work to be on their side. We need a collaboration of civil rights, health, academic, activist and government professionals to alleviate their pain -- from a short-term and long-term perspective.
